Your mother is right. If you have April vacation, that's when to start. Go to maybe half of your possible choices then, and the rest over the summer. Do a road trip over the vacation, don't fly. Visit the local ones, within maybe 3 states if you're on the east coast.

No that is not too soon at all. We had already visited 4 schools by second semester junior year.
Call up two weeks ahead of time. get a meeting with admissions and a tour of the campus. We also met with the head of the department or a teacher from the department of the majors she was interested in. we ate in the dining halls at the colleges.

it takes time to go visit colleges. Often we would spent the night at a hotel, we checked out a couple of schools 4/5 hours away.

You need to figure out if a small or large school is best for you. You can really get a feel for the school and if it is for you
